For all individuals that live in the United States and occasionally visit the erotic section, you probably know that Craigslist, one of the largest adult classifieds, has eliminated its "adult services" section. Craigslist has also shutdown it's erotic section in Canada.
Approximately 30% of Craigslist's overall income was generated from listings in that adult section. At about $10 per listing, that comes out to an estimated $37 million that Craigslist has lost because of this. For anyone who is curious; that fee is fairly similar to what any major newspaper charges for a similar posting in their own classified area.
